Sherlock Holmes: On His Knees

So, Sherlock Holmes and John Watson: just friends? Since the great detective and his fearless chronicler hit the pages of the Strand Magazine in the 1890's, readers have speculated about the nature of their relationship.

I have been trying to answer that question for years myself, at great length, in as much detail and as many positions as I can manage. My debut full-length novel, Compound a Felony, is a queer, erotic reimagining of the downtime between cases– an exploration of the power dynamic and romance simmering under the surface of the fabled Holmes and Watson partnership.

Sherlock Holmes may be a veritable whirlwind of logic and intellect, but without an anchor he's in danger of coming undone altogether. When he meets John Watson, war veteran and ex-army surgeon, he doesn't know what he's getting himself into. But Watson seems to understand that what he needs is a firm hand and a release of control. Somehow, with a little communication and a lot of trust, they muddle their way through a relationship that turns out to be one for the ages.

Compound a Felony: A Queer Affair of Sherlock Holmes will be available from Full Fathom Five Digital on July 29th.
